Construction jobs in the UK encompass a broad range of roles, including architects, project managers, builders, and tradespeople. Professionals contribute to residential, commercial, and infrastructure projects, playing a pivotal role in the country's development. Key skills involve project coordination, technical expertise, and adherence to safety regulations. Challenges include demanding physical work, fluctuating weather conditions, and tight timelines. Despite these challenges, the construction industry remains a cornerstone of the UK economy, offering diverse career opportunities. It emphasizes teamwork, craftsmanship, and innovation, contributing significantly to the nation's infrastructure and urban landscape.
